Taking your vacation reservations for June – August! This charming cottage is nestled on the hills of Eagle Crest, a quiet Northside Holland neighborhood. This updated 1940s era property affords partial views of Lake Michigan from the deck and both levels of the home. There are 3 beach access points within this informal association community, including one in front of the home, giving easy access to Holland’s famed State Park and Tunnel Park, among nearby popular beach options. The location in Holland was great with lots to do, including biking, shopping, and the public beaches. The house is in the woods, with lots of nature and a fairly good view of the lake. Be prepared for the 100 stairs to the beach and single lane, hilly drive. Parking for additional and/or large vehicles is less than ideal. The layout of the house was great. The house is older but a classic Lake Michigan home. Bathrooms are updated. There easily could have been room for two more adults on air mattresses in the upstairs bedroom. It was a bit disappointing that there was not a beach for association members but it was great to have a neighbor that was willing to let us be on their section of beach. Cottage is updated and was very clean. Macataw realty was amazing, few issues we had were quickly resolved. The cottage is a older but has modern amenities. It has plenty of space for 6+, and woods setting makes it very serene. The yard needs some attention but it has real potential as there are paths and sitting areas throughout.
Only negative, which is not in control of cottage owner, is the lack of beach due to the high levels of lake michigan. Pictures of a few years back show a wide beach, which is mostly gone now but can still walk to Holland State Park or Tunnel Beach for better experience. Also, the modern house across the street, which is really out of place, blocks a lot of the view of the lake.
